Title:
TRANSMISSION METHOD AND DEVICE BASED ON PREAMBLE PUNCTURING IN WIRELESS LAN SYSTEM
Document Type and Number:
WIPO Patent Application WO/2022/220487
Kind Code:
A1
Abstract:
A transmission method and device based on preamble puncturing in a wireless LAN system are disclosed. A method by which a first STA performs communication in a wireless LAN system, according to one embodiment of the present disclosure, comprises the steps of: receiving a first PPDU from a second STA; acquiring information related to at least one first punctured resource unit; and transmitting, in response to the first PPDU, to the second STA, a second PPDU based on at least one second punctured resource unit, wherein the at least one first punctured resource unit can be at least one part of the at least one second punctured resource unit.
